Brother’s Gift of Life: Shalby Hospital Surat Performs Successful Kidney Transplant

Posted on May 29, 2025 By

Surat (Gujarat) [India], May 29: Offering a young woman fighting end-stage renal disease a fresh lease on life, Shalby Hospital in Surat has effectively carried out a life-saving kidney transplant, attesting to medical excellence and human resilience.

Travel from hopelessness to hope

After three years of triple weekly dialysis, the patient arrived with a baseline serum creatinine level of 10 mg/dL and no urine output, signs of severe kidney dysfunction. Her creatinine levels remarkably normalised to 1 mg/dL after transplant, and she started passing urine clearly, indicating good graft performance and a good surgical result.

Mastery Underlying the Success

Under the direction of Chief Nephrologist Dr. Mukesh Goyal and Chief Urologist and Transplant Surgeon Dr. Juhil Nanavati, a seasoned transplant team painstakingly carried out this difficult operation. Having done over 500 kidney transplants in Hyderabad, Dr. Goyal brings a great deal of expertise; Dr. Nanavati has effectively completed more than 250 kidney transplants in New Delhi.

A dedicated team, including Dr. Kevin Desai and his anaesthesia unit, Dr. Arool Shukla supervising intensive care, and dedicated nurses and resident medical officers, supported their combined efforts.
